5055615 has 56 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 9705840. Its totient is φ = 2519424.
The previous prime is 5055601. The next prime is 5055623. The reversal of 5055615 is 5165505.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 5055615 - 26 = 5055551 is a prime.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(27).
5055615 is a lucky number.
It is a congruent number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(13)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 55 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 69219 + ... + 69291.
Almost surely, 25055615 is an apocalyptic number.
5055615 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(4650225).
5055615 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
5055615 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 115 (or 100 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 3750, while the sum is 27.
The square root of 5055615 is about 2248.4694794460. The cubic root of 5055615 is about 171.6292605001.
The spelling of 5055615 in words is "five million, fifty-five thousand, six hundred fifteen".
